How Do You Get Started in a Medical Scribing Career?

Starting a career in medical scribing can be an excellent way to enter the healthcare field without requiring extensive schooling. Here’s how you can get started:

1. Understand the Role: A medical scribe works alongside doctors, documenting patient encounters in real-time. You’ll be responsible for taking detailed notes, updating electronic health records (EHR), and ensuring that patient information is accurately recorded.

2. Education and Training: While a college degree isn’t always necessary, having a background in health sciences or related fields can be beneficial. Some employers may require a high school diploma, while others prefer candidates with post-secondary education. Specialized training programs for medical scribes, either online or in-person, can give you a significant advantage. These programs typically cover medical terminology, anatomy, and the basics of EHR systems.

3. Gain Certification:
Although certification is not mandatory, obtaining a certification from organizations like the American Healthcare Documentation Professionals Group (AHDPG) or the American College of Medical Scribe Specialists (ACMSS) can boost your employability.

4. Develop Essential Skills: Strong typing skills, attention to detail, and a good understanding of medical terminology are crucial. You should also be comfortable working in fast-paced environments and be able to quickly adapt to different medical settings.

5. Apply for Positions: Once trained, you can start applying for medical scribe positions at hospitals, clinics, or through scribe staffing agencies. Networking with professionals in the field and attending job fairs can also help you find job opportunities.

6. Build Experience: As you gain experience, you may have opportunities to specialize in certain areas of medicine or advance into roles with more responsibility, such as lead scribe or scribe trainer.

Starting as a medical scribe can be a rewarding pathway into the healthcare industry, offering hands-on experience and a potential stepping stone to other medical careers.
